Why This Site Exists
Baldwin Park records are not kept by one local counter. The Los Angeles County Registrar-Recorder/County Clerk handles real estate records, marriage records, fictitious business names, and many vital-record functions. Los Angeles Superior Court publishes civil and criminal name-search portals. The Los Angeles County Assessor ties parcels to assessment data, while voter information is governed by California election law. City records still run through the Baldwin Park City Clerk, including public-records requests for city departments. This site brings those search paths, office contacts, and access limits into one Baldwin Park reference.
